The four senior players, Mohammad Hafeez, Wahab Riaz, Shoaib Malik, and Mohammad Amir are to get their salaries according to A category. The renewal in the policy is because of the justified demands of the players.

Notably, the four players were getting paid in the C category as either they were not parts of the latest central contracts proposed by the Pakistan Cricket Board (PCB) or were demotivated to the C category.

According to the pre-existing policy, a player outside of the central contract pool will be getting a C category salary but there is a twist in the policy as Amir, Wahab, Hafeez, and Malik are to get the salaries on behalf of their careers and seniority.

Notably, Malik and Hafeez were axed from the central contracts in 2019, and on the other hand, Amir and Wahab were swiped to the C category.

“The four players made a logical and reasonable request to the PCB prior to the Zimbabwe series,” a PCB spokesperson said.

“The PCB, taking into consideration their seniority and accepting that their request has merit, agreed to pay their match fees in accordance with Category A scales for all matches they will play from the series against Zimbabwe until 30 June 2021,” he added.\

Note: Malik and Amir are not parts of the 35 member squad against New Zealand as they have been headed to Sri Lanka for the Lanka Premier League (LPL). While Hafeez and Wahab are the parts of the squad and will be seen playing against New Zealand.
